Preparatory courses
The long-term Mathematics and Czech Language course will prepare Year 9 pupils for the CERMAT unified entrance examination for four-year grammar schools, which takes place on 9 and 12 April 2027. The courses are led by experienced grammar school teachers and take place in person at the school building at Na Příkopě 850/8, Praha 1.
You can choose complete preparation in both subjects, or a standalone Mathematics or Czech Language course. Lessons take place on Tuesday and Thursday afternoons, or on Saturday mornings.

What you will practise on the courses
For Year 9 pupils · 24 lessons
Mathematics
In each lesson we work through two sample tests and cover a further one as homework. We proceed systematically from the basics to the more complex tasks typical of the CERMAT tests.
- Arithmetic and fractions
- Unit conversions
- Equations and expressions
- Word problems
- Percentages and statistics
- Angles and plane geometry
- Solid geometry
- Construction tasks
For Year 9 pupils · 24 lessons
Czech Language
We work with model tests, simulate the real exam, and practise both problem-solving strategy and time management — from language phenomena to reading literacy.
- Spelling
- Morphology
- Syntax and complex sentences
- Vocabulary
- Stylistics
- Working with text
- Literary essentials

Frequently asked questions about the courses
Who are the courses for?
For Year 9 pupils applying to four-year grammar schools and secondary schools who face the CERMAT unified entrance examination.
Can I sign up for just one subject?
Yes. In addition to the complete course, we offer a standalone Mathematics course (24 lessons, 9 700 Kč) and a Czech Language course (24 lessons, 9 700 Kč).
How do the lessons work?
Each lesson lasts 90 minutes. In Mathematics, we work through two sample tests in each lesson and set one as homework; in Czech, we work with model tests and practise problem-solving strategy and time management.
When do the courses not take place?
During the autumn half-term (29–30 October 2026), the Christmas holidays (23 December 2026 – 3 January 2027), and the spring half-term (22–28 February 2027).
